How they compare
Ghana currently reports 3,239 t against 2,911 t in Kyrgyzstan, a difference of 328 t.
That makes Ghana's figure about 1.1 times Kyrgyzstan's.
The two have swapped places 6 times across 32 shared years of data; in 1992 it was Ghana ahead.
Ghana ranks 72nd and Kyrgyzstan ranks 75th of 185 countries.
Across the 4 decades both report, Ghana averaged higher in 3 and Kyrgyzstan in 1.

About this data
The Cropland Nutrient balance domain contains information on the flows of nitrogen, phosphorus, and potassium from mineral fertilizer, manure applied, atmospheric deposition, crop removal, and biological fixation over cropland and per unit area of cropland. The flows are aggregated to total inputs and total outputs, from which the overall nutrient balance and nutrient use efficiency on cropland are calculated. Statistics are disseminated in units of tonnes and in kg/ha, as appropriate. Nutrient use efficiency is expressed as a fraction (%).
